Has a CFL game ever ended 54-24?
Exactly once. On July 31, 1991, Edmonton Eskimos beat Saskatchewan Roughriders 54-24, and no CFL game before or since has ended that way. When it happened it was a scorigami, the first 54-24 in league history.
That makes 54-24 the 850th most common final score out of 1,183 that have ever occurred in CFL. One point away, 55-24 has happened 1 times and 54-25 has happened 1 times.
